Sub: Payment of difference on arrears of TA/DA arising out of Railway Board’s letter No.F(E)I/2011/AL22 dt.29.4.14.
One of the Railways has sought clarification regarding supplementary claim for difference of TA/DA arising out of enhancement of Dearness allowance up to 100% w.e.f. 1.1.14 after issue of Board’s letter NO.F(E)/2011/AL/28/18 dated
29.04.14.
2. The matter has been examined in Board’s office and it is clarified that where TA/DA has been paid at old rates supplementary claims for difference of TA/DA would be admissible in respect of official tours made on or after 01.01.14 consequent to increase in the rates of TA/DA by 25%, w.e.f. 01.01.2014.
3. This disposes of South Eastern Railways letter No.ENG/Bills/TA&DA/604 dated 25.08.2015.
